如何把一个Excel文件放到ASP页面中去?

网络编程 2025-03-23 22:04www.168986.cn编程入门

在无声无息中,我们启动了一个Excel程序来处理一份名为“精彩春风通讯录”的数据表。在这段程序中,我们没有展示出Excel窗口,而是默默地在后台完成了所有操作。这是如何做到的呢?让我们来详细解读一下这段代码。

我们创建了一个新的Excel应用程序对象,并设置其为不可见状态。这意味着我们在服务器上运行Excel程序时,用户无法看到其界面。然后,我们添加了一个新的工作簿,并获取其第一个工作表。在工作表的特定单元格中,我们填充了数据并设置了表头,使得数据表具有“姓名”,“地址”,“电话”和“手机”四个字段。我们还将表头进行了加粗显示,使得它们更加醒目。

接下来,我们为每个会话生成一个唯一的文件名,确保每次生成的Excel文件都是独特的。这个文件名是基于会话ID生成的,确保了每个用户都能获得一个独特的文件。然后,我们确定了文件的保存路径,并将其保存到服务器上。

在完成文件的保存后,我们关闭了工作簿并退出Excel程序。我们将处理后的Excel文件重定向到浏览器,使得用户可以在浏览器中直接下载并打开这个文件。整个过程在无声无息中完成,用户只需要等待下载即可。

这样的处理方式非常适合需要大量处理Excel数据的场景,比如制作报表、数据分析等。通过服务器端处理Excel数据,我们可以大大提高处理效率,减少用户等待时间。我们还利用了Excel的强大功能,使得处理后的数据表具有清晰的结构和布局。

这段代码还具有高度的灵活性和可扩展性。我们可以根据需要修改数据表的字段和内容,甚至可以添加更多的功能,比如数据验证、公式计算等。这段代码是一个强大的工具,可以帮助我们在服务器端高效处理Excel数据,为用户提供更好的服务体验。

现在,[1]这个标志已经指向了我们的ASP页面,也就是浏览器中的文件下载页面。用户只需要点击下载链接,就可以获得他们需要的Excel文件了。这是一个便捷、高效的数据处理方式,让我们能够更好地满足用户的需求。

Copyright © 2016-2025 www.168986.cn 狼蚁网络 版权所有 Power by